Title
Approving the application of Lululemon Athletica for a sound level variance in order to use an amplifier and speakers for an emcee and DJ at the start/finish of a race event on Saturday, September 20, 2014 at the corner of Summit Avenue (south side of Median) and Mississippi River Boulevard.
Body
WHEREAS, Chapter 293 of the Saint Paul Legislative Code was enacted to regulate the subject of noise in the City of Saint Paul; and
WHEREAS, §293.09 provides for the granting of variances from the sound level limitations contained in §293.07, upon a finding by the City Council that full compliance with Chapter 293 would constitute an unreasonable hardship on the applicant, other persons or on the community; and
WHEREAS, Lululemon Athletica, represented by Kara Schlosser, Store Manager, who has been designated as the responsible person on the application, has applied for a variance to use an amplifier and speakers to project sound for an emcee and DJ at the start/finish of a race event at the corner of Summit Avenue (south side of Median) and Mississippi River Boulevard during a Lululemon Athletica Event; and
   
WHEREAS, applicant is seeking a variance for the 7:30 a.m. to 12:00 p.m. on Saturday, September 20, 2014, and
   
WHEREAS, if applicant is not granted a variance it will not be able to use an amplifier and speakers to project sound for an emcee and DJ at the start/finish of a race event at the corner of Summit Avenue (south side of Median) and Mississippi River Boulevard; and
   
WHEREAS, the Department of Safety and Inspections has reviewed the application and has made recommendations regarding conditions for the variance; now, therefore, be it
   
RESOLVED, that the Council of the City of Saint Paul hereby grants a variance to Kara Schlosser and Lululemon Athletica, for the following race event location, at the corner of Summit Avenue (south side of Median) and Mississippi River Boulevard, and subject to the following conditions:
1.   Sound levels shall be limited to 85 dBA as measured 50 feet from noise source.
 2.   Speakers and stage must be directed away from residential use properties.  All electronically powered equipment, PA systems, loudspeakers or similar devices used in conjunction with the event must not exceed 85 dBA as measured 50 feet from sound source.
3.   Variance will be for the hours of 7:30 a.m. to 12:00 p.m. on September 20, 2014.
4.   The applicant shall provide personnel and equipment who shall provide continuous sound level monitoring at each sound mix during the hours of the variance.
5.   All electronically powered equipment, PA systems, loudspeakers or similar devices shall be turned off no later than 12:00 p.m.
FURTHER RESOLVED, that any violations of the conditions set forth above on the September 20, 2014 event date may result in denial of future requests for the grant of a noise variance, in addition to any criminal citation which might issue.
